Changing the picture adjustment

You can adjust

BRIGHT (brightness),

CONTRAST (contrast), COLOR (color) and
HUE (hue) for each source and rear view cam-
era.

! The adjustments of BRIGHT and

CONTRAST are stored separately for light
ambient (daytime) and dark ambient (night-
time). A sun

or moon

is displayed to

the left of

BRIGHT and CONTRAST, respec-

tively, as the ambient light sensor deter-
mines brightness or darkness.

! You cannot adjust COLOR or HUE for the

audio source.

1

Press V.ADJ and hold to display

PICTURE ADJUST.
Press

V.ADJ until PICTURE ADJUST appears

in the display.

2

Touch any of the following touch panel

keys to select the function to be adjusted.
The adjustment function names are displayed
and adjustable ones are highlighted.

! BRIGHT – Adjust the black intensity
! CONTRAST – Adjust the contrast
! COLOR – Adjust the color saturation
! HUE – Adjust the tone of color (red is em-

phasized or green is emphasized)

! DIMMER – Adjust the brightness of display
! BACK-CAMERA – Switch to the picture ad-

justment display for the rear view camera

# You can adjust the picture adjustment for rear
view camera only when

B-CAM is turned on.

(Refer to Setting for rear view camera (back up
camera) on page 41.)

# With some rear view cameras, picture adjust-
ment may not be possible.

3

Touch c or d to adjust the selected

item.
Each time you touch c or d it increases or de-
creases the level of selected item.

+24 to

–24

is displayed as the level is increased or de-
creased.

4

Touch ESC to hide the touch panel keys.

Adjusting the dimmer

The adjustment of

DIMMER is stored sepa-

rately for each ambient light; daytime, evening
and nighttime. The brightness of LCD screen
will be adjusted to optimum level automati-
cally in accordance with the ambient light
based on the setting values.

1

Press V.ADJ and hold to display

PICTURE ADJUST.
Press

V.ADJ until PICTURE ADJUST appears

in the display.

2

Touch DIMMER.

The ambient light level used as the standard
for adjusting

DIMMER appears above the level

bar.

! Red sun

– Adjust the brightness for

bright ambient light (daytime)

! White sun

– Adjust the brightness for in-

termediate brightness (evening)

! Blue moon

– Adjust the brightness for

dark ambient light (nighttime)

3

Touch c or d to adjust the brightness.

Each time you touch c or d moves the key to-
wards the left or the right.
The level indicates the brightness of the
screen being adjusted. The farther the key
moves to the right, the brighter the screen.

4

Touch ESC to hide the touch panel keys.

Note

The icons indicating the current ambient bright-
ness used for adjusting

BRIGHT and CONTRAST

may differ from

DIMMER slightly.
